Endeavour Touches Down at Dryden in California

Space Shuttle Endeavour attached to the Shuttle Carrier Aircraft (SCA) touched down at Dryden Flight Research Center (DFRC) at Edwards Air Force Base in California today after leaving Ellington Field near Johnson Space Center in Houston, Texas earlier this morning. Endeavour will remain overnight at Dryden before leaving at sunrise for her final destination, Los Angeles.

Source: NASA Television

Shuttle Endeavour's Retirement> View More Shuttle Endeavour's Retirement Videos